Biology's need for speed tolerates a few mistakes

Tuesday, May 2, 2017 - 14:21 in Biology & Nature

Biology must be in a hurry. In balancing speed and accuracy to duplicate DNA, produce proteins and carry out other processes, evolution has apparently determined that speed is of higher priority, according to Rice University researchers.
